Cómo configurar NGINX en el contenedor Docker de Discourse

Mi foro de Discourse se está ejecutando en la dirección forum.example.com. Quiero configurar NGINX en el contenedor Docker de Discourse y seguí las instrucciones aquí
Run other websites on the same machine as Discourse
Después de completar la configuración según las instrucciones, encontré un error “ERR_TOO_MANY_REDIRECTS”


¿Alguna sugerencia o idea para solucionar esto?

¿Quieres decir que quieres usar un nginx externo como proxy inverso por alguna razón?

Hay un nginx dentro del contenedor de discourse y está configurado.

¿Qué problema intentas resolver?

Necesitarás compartir detalles más explícitos sobre lo que hiciste.

Mi deseo es usar forum.example.com/forum para el foro y forum.example.com para una página HTML.
Busqué una solución y descubrí que necesito configurar un proxy nginx adicional delante del contenedor Docker.
Intenté seguir las instrucciones anteriores, pero el resultado no fue exitoso.

1 me gusta

Ver Servir Discourse desde una subcarpeta (prefijo de ruta) en lugar de un subdominio.

He leído este artículo y dice que requiere clientes alojados a nivel empresarial para poder usarlo. ¿Es correcto?

Sí, eso es cierto para los clientes alojados. Pero si lees después de esto:

Describe cómo hacerlo en tu propio servidor. Sin embargo, las advertencias de que es difícil, complicado y no muy recomendable son todas ciertas. La mayoría de la gente ahora está de acuerdo en que no hay ninguna ventaja de SEO en el uso de una subcarpeta.

2 Me gusta